She is survived by her husband, Joseph of Janesville; a daughter, Mrs. William (Deanna) Riley of Edgerton; four grandchildren, Mrs. Earl (Lee Ann) Herring of Janesville, Kathy Riley of Milton, William J. Riley and Kelly Riley, both of Edgerton; two great-grandchildren, Joseph and Holly Herring of Janesville; two sisters, Mrs. Agnes Steenberg of Westby and Mrs. Clarence (Thelma) Dahlen of Coon Valley; two brothers, Morgan Bekkum of Chicago and Theodore Bekkum of Dubuque, Iowa. She was preceded in death by her parents and a sister, Ruby, and two brothers, Otis and Milnor.
Services will be Monday at 11 a.m. in Coon Valley Lutheran Church, the Rev. William Mueller officiating, with burial in the church cemetery. Friends may call at the church Monday from 9 a.m. until time of services. Seland Funeral Home, Coon Valley, is in charge of arrangements.
